Figure 1

Test Sheets. The original test sheet (left image) was printed first and subsequently had 2 lines drawn on it with each pen, yielding toner-first samples. The second test sheet (right image) was then printed on the same sheet, yielding ink-first samples.

Figure 4

Erasable Inks. In the top row are toner-first (left image) and ink-first (right image) intersections with Pilot Frixion Ball Erasable Fine Blue pen after standard toner removal. The ink line is not visible in the ink-first sample. In the second row are toner-first (left image) and ink-first (right image) intersections when the toner removal was conducted after freezing. Note that the ink line is present in the ink-first sample. In the third row are toner-first (left image) and ink-first (right image) intersections imaged with a spot filter of the VSC.

Figure 5

Comparison of Toner Removal Instruments. Examples of intersections of toner and the Pentel Energel Deluxe Fine Red pen after freezing and toner removal. An ink-first intersection using the X-Acto razor blade (left image) and an ink-first intersection using the needle (right image) show results were common for each instrument.

Figure 6

Comparison of Standard v. Freezing. In the top row are toner-first (left image) and ink-first (right image) intersections with the Bic Round Stic Black pen after standard toner removal. In the second row are toner-first (left image) and ink first (right image) intersections with the Bic Round Stic Black pen after freezing and toner removal. Note that the bottom-left image indicates that the ink penetrated the toner.
